WebMine dewatering is the action of removing groundwater from a mine. When a mine extends below the water table groundwater will, due to gravity, infiltrate the mine working. On some projects groundwater is a minor impediment that can be dealt with on an ad-hoc basis. In other mines, and in other geological settings, dewatering is fundamental to the viability of … Web18 Jun 2024 · Sludge thickening and dewatering processes normally require pre-treatment to assist the separation of the water from the solids.
